Choosing where to start is the hardest part! Central Otago is breathtaking, with vast undulating landscapes, rugged snow-capped mountains, clear blue rivers and tussock-clad hills. The gem of this region is the multitude of wineries , many world-renowned for their Pinot Noir.
Meet the wine-makers, stroll or bike through the vines and savour the best of this region. Located 33 kilometres from Hokitika on the West Coast, The Hokitika Gorge is one of those places that look as good in photos as in real life. The vivid turquoise water surrounded by lush native bush looks too good to be true but trust us, it is well worth a visit.
The sheltered bays of Abel Tasman National Park are perfect for sailing or kayaking, with ample opportunity to see the seals and dolphins who regularly play in these coastal waters. If you prefer to explore by land, the park is a great place to walk. Hike the Abel Tasman Coastal Track and follow the coastline through native bush, past limestone cliffs and along golden beaches.
